Programmiersprachen sind heutzutage sehr gefragt. Die meisten Unternehmen suchen nach Programmierern, um ihre Software und Apps zu entwickeln. Aber welche Programmiersprache lohnt sich am meisten zu lernen? Hier sind einige der beliebtesten Sprachen und ihre Verwendungszwecke:
Java ist eine sehr beliebte Programmiersprache, die hauptsächlich für die Entwicklung von mobilen Apps, Webanwendungen und Spielen verwendet wird. Es ist jedoch auch in der Finanzindustrie sehr gefragt, da es eine hohe Sicherheit und eine gute Performance bietet. Es ist auch eine Compilersprache, was bedeutet, dass der Code in Bytecode übersetzt wird, der dann von der Java Virtual Machine (JVM) ausgeführt wird.
Python ist eine weitere sehr beliebte Programmiersprache. Es ist bekannt für seine Einfachheit und Flexibilität und wird oft für Webentwicklung, künstliche Intelligenz, Datenanalyse und wissenschaftliches Rechnen verwendet. Python ist auch eine Interpretiersprache, was bedeutet, dass der Code direkt ausgeführt wird und nicht in eine ausführbare Datei umgewandelt werden muss.
Um Python am besten zu lernen, empfiehlt es sich, ein Buch oder einen Online-Kurs zu verwenden. Es gibt viele kostenlose Ressourcen wie Codecademy, die Ihnen helfen können, die Grundlagen zu erlernen. Es gibt auch Bücher wie „Python Crashkurs“ von Eric Matthes, die Ihnen helfen können, fortgeschrittenere Konzepte zu verstehen.
HTML ist eine Auszeichnungssprache, die für die Erstellung von Webseiten verwendet wird. Es ist jedoch wichtig zu verstehen, dass HTML keine Programmiersprache ist. Es ist eine strukturierte Sprache, die verwendet wird, um den Inhalt einer Webseite zu kennzeichnen. CSS ist eine weitere Sprache, die verwendet wird, um das Aussehen einer Webseite zu gestalten. Auch CSS ist keine Programmiersprache, sondern eine Stylesheet-Sprache.
Um HTML und CSS zu lernen, empfiehlt es sich, Online-Kurse und Tutorials zu verwenden. Es gibt viele kostenlose Ressourcen wie W3Schools, die Ihnen helfen können, die Grundlagen zu erlernen. Es gibt auch Bücher wie „HTML und CSS“ von Jon Duckett, die Ihnen helfen können, fortgeschrittenere Konzepte zu verstehen.
Zusammenfassend lässt sich sagen, dass die Wahl der Programmiersprache von den Anforderungen des Projekts abhängt. Java ist gut für die Entwicklung von mobilen Apps und Webanwendungen geeignet, während Python für künstliche Intelligenz und Datenanalyse verwendet wird. HTML und CSS sind Auszeichnungssprachen, die für die Erstellung von Webseiten verwendet werden. Es ist wichtig zu verstehen, dass sie keine Programmiersprachen sind. Um eine Programmiersprache oder eine Auszeichnungssprache zu erlernen, empfiehlt es sich, Online-Kurse und Bücher als Ressourcen zu verwenden.
Unter objektorientierter Programmierung versteht man eine Programmierparadigma, bei der die Programmierung auf Objekten basiert. Objekte sind dabei Instanzen von Klassen, die Daten und Methoden enthalten. Die Programmierung erfolgt durch Interaktion mit den Objekten und deren Methoden. Durch die Verwendung von Klassen und Objekten wird eine modularere und strukturiertere Programmierung ermöglicht.
Ja, R ist eine objektorientierte Programmiersprache.
Die drei Grundprinzipien der objektorientierten Programmierung (OOP) sind Vererbung, Polymorphie und Datenkapselung.